Houses attacked

Published September 8, 2006

QUETTA, Sept 7: Hand grenades were hurled on two houses in different areas here, police said here on Thursday. According to police, some people threw a grenade into the house of Shakil in the New Nichari area on Thursday afternoon. Windowpanes were smashed and walls and the roof of the house were damaged in the explosion. Another grenade was hurled at the house of Mohammad Nawaz in the new Sariab area late Wednesday night. No casualty was reported in the two explosions. Police registered cases against unidentified people.—Staff Correspondent
